The Ministerio de Seguridad Tucumán plays a critical role in maintaining public safety, law enforcement, and emergency management in the province of Tucumán, Argentina. This government institution is responsible for developing policies, coordinating security forces, and ensuring the protection of citizens in both urban and rural areas. Understanding the structure, responsibilities, and initiatives of the Ministerio de Seguridad Tucumán provides valuable insight into how public security operates in one of Argentina’s most populous provinces. From policing strategies to community outreach programs, the ministry aims to create a safe environment while addressing crime prevention and emergency response.
Overview of Ministerio de Seguridad Tucumán
The Ministerio de Seguridad Tucumán is the provincial agency responsible for security, law enforcement, and public protection. It functions under the provincial government and works in coordination with national authorities when necessary. Its primary mission is to implement security policies, reduce crime rates, and ensure public safety for residents and visitors across the province. The ministry also plays a key role in coordinating emergency services and disaster response, highlighting its importance beyond policing alone.
Main Responsibilities
- Implementing law enforcement policies and strategies.
- Overseeing provincial police forces and specialized units.
- Coordinating emergency and disaster response efforts.
- Developing programs to prevent crime and promote public safety.
- Collaborating with other government institutions and civil organizations.
Structure of the Ministry
The ministry is structured to ensure efficient management of security operations throughout Tucumán. It includes several departments and divisions, each focused on specific aspects of public safety
Police Division
The Police Division manages day-to-day law enforcement activities, patrols, investigations, and criminal response. This division ensures that urban and rural areas are monitored, and it responds to emergencies in coordination with other government agencies. Specialized units within the police division address organized crime, narcotics, and traffic enforcement.
Emergency Management Division
The Emergency Management Division is responsible for disaster preparedness, coordination of rescue operations, and civil defense planning. It provides support during natural disasters, accidents, and public emergencies, ensuring rapid response and efficient resource allocation.
Community and Crime Prevention Division
This division focuses on programs that reduce crime through education, awareness campaigns, and community involvement. Initiatives include neighborhood watch programs, youth engagement activities, and public workshops aimed at improving safety awareness among citizens.
